Forward market

The forward market is the over-the-counter financial market in contracts for future delivery, so called forward contracts. Forward contracts are personalized between parties. The forward market is a general term used to describe the informal market by which these contracts are entered into. Standardized forward contracts are called futures contracts and traded on a futures exchange.

It should not be confused with the futures market.
